A Background to 3D Printing in Belgium

Belgium began its journey with 3D printing in the early 1990s, with the founding of Materialise, a leader in additive manufacturing software and solutions. Since then, the country has developed a robust 3D printing ecosystem, including research institutions, technology providers, service bureaus, and end-users.

Several factors have contributed to Belgium's success in the 3D printing industry:

1. Strong academic and research infrastructure: Belgian universities and research centers have played a vital role in advancing additive manufacturing technologies. For example, KU Leuven and Ghent University boast world-class research facilities and are at the forefront of 3D printing innovations.

2. Government support: The Belgian government has recognized the importance of 3D printing and actively supports the growth of the industry through research grants, innovation clusters, and other incentives.

3. Collaborative business atmosphere: Belgium's 3D printing service providers often collaborate on projects and share knowledge to drive innovations in the industry, creating a healthy and competitive environment for growth.

4. Geographical advantage: With its central location in Europe, Belgium serves as an ideal hub for 3D printing-centric businesses, facilitating easy access to European markets, suppliers, and customers.

Belgian 3D Printing Services and Solutions

Belgium offers a wide variety of 3D printing services, catering to diverse industries and applications. Here are some of the most prominent services and solutions available for businesses and individuals alike:

1. Rapid prototyping and product development: Many Belgian 3D printing companies specialize in creating prototypes and iterating designs quickly, allowing clients to bring their products to market faster.

2. Customized and small-batch production: Additive manufacturing enables cost-effective production of intricate and complex designs in low volumes. Belgian service bureaus cater to several industries, such as automotive, aerospace, and healthcare, for bespoke and small-batch production requirements.

3. 3D printing materials and technologies: Belgian printers possess extensive expertise in working with various 3D printing materials, like plastics, metals, ceramics, and even biodegradable options. Additionally, they offer a vast range of printing technologies, including Fused Deposition Modeling (FDM), Stereolithography (SLA), Selective Laser Sintering (SLS), and Direct Metal Laser Sintering (DMLS).

4. Consultancy and training: Aside from 3D printing services, Belgium also offers a wealth of knowledge exchange through consultancy, training workshops, and seminars aimed at helping businesses and individuals understand and adopt additive manufacturing techniques most effectively.

3D Printing Innovations from Belgian Companies

Belgium has continued to be an incubator of innovation, producing several groundbreaking advancements in the world of 3D printing. Some notable applications and breakthroughs include:

1. Bioprinting:\

Belgian researchers are exploring bioprinting applications, such as using 3D-printed scaffolds to grow human tissues and organs. These advancements have significant implications for the medical and healthcare sectors.

2. Construction:\

In Belgium, companies such as Kamp C have been experimenting with 3D-printed houses, showcasing a promising future for sustainable and affordable construction methods.

3. Fashion:\

Belgian designers have been pushing the boundaries of fashion with 3D-printed garments and accessories, opening new dimensions in apparel customization and on-demand production.

3D printing materials

Plastics

One of the most commonly used 3D printing materials. These materials include ABS, PLA, PETG, TPU, PEEK, etc. Each material has different physical and chemical properties and can be suitable for different application scenarios.

Metal

Metal 3D printing materials include titanium alloy, aluminum alloy, stainless steel, nickel alloy, etc. Metal 3D printing can produce complex components and molds, with advantages such as high strength and high wear resistance.

Ceramic

Ceramic 3D printing materials include alumina, zirconia, silicate, etc. Ceramic 3D printing can produce high-precision ceramic products, such as ceramic parts, ceramic sculptures, etc.
